Why Live in Red Lion

Red Lion, PA, is a small, close-knit community with a rich history dating back to 1852. Originally established around the Maryland and Pennsylvania Railroad, the town has evolved into a vibrant area with a strong sense of local pride. Residents enjoy a walkable environment, with convenient access to coffee shops, convenience stores, and parks. Main Street and Broadway are home to unique local businesses, including cafes, breweries, and shops offering collectibles and local art. Dining options such as Sign of the Horse and Phat Cat Coffee provide casual atmospheres for enjoying seasonal lattes and brunch pastries. Red Lion hosts lively annual festivals, including the Suds and Songs festival and the Red Lion Street Fair, which feature local bands, vendors, and food trucks. The town's historic charm is reflected in its architecture, with American Foursquare homes and townhouses prevalent in the central area, while ranch-style and split-level homes are more common on the outskirts. The Ma and Pa Greenway offers scenic walking and biking paths, connecting residents to shopping centers and Fairmount Park, which features a splash pad and picnic areas. Red Lion Area Senior High School is noted for its championship football team. Located 10 miles from York, Red Lion provides access to city amenities, though public transportation options are limited. Harrisburg International Airport is 35 miles away, offering further travel opportunities.
